Yeon Sang-ho Returns to Thriller Territory with "Colony"

"Train to Busan" director Yeon Sang-ho is diving back into the world of thrilling horror with his upcoming film, "Colony." This new project features a star-studded cast including Gianna Jun, Koo Kyo-hwan, Ji Chang-wook, and Shin Hyun-been, promising a cinematic experience that will grip audiences. The premise revolves around a biotechnology conference that descends into utter chaos. A rapidly mutating virus breaks out, transforming those infected into something monstrous. As the situation spirals out of control, authorities are forced to seal off the facility, trapping the survivors within its walls. "Super Mario World" Title Leaked (Then Scrubbed!) for Upcoming Sequel

An apparent slip-up by NBCUniversal may have revealed the title of the highly anticipated sequel to "The Super Mario Bros. Movie." A press release for upcoming Peacock streaming content unintentionally mentioned the film as "Super Mario World," a clear reference to the classic 1990 SNES game. However, the mention of the movie title was quickly scrubbed from the press release hours after publication, leaving fans speculating. This could suggest that the title is indeed accurate but was revealed prematurely, or it could be a simple error. Kate Mara to Star in Vampire Romantic Comedy, "She Kills Them"

Kate Mara is set to star in a unique project that blends horror, romance, and comedy. "She Kills Them" is described as "Buffy the Vampire Slayer meets Fleabag," promising a witty and action-packed take on the vampire genre. Directed by Dan Clark, the film follows Chloe Jacobs, a woman in her late 30s leading a double life. By night, she seduces and slays vampires as part of a secret government operation. By day, she’s just another jaded New Yorker struggling to navigate her personal life. The story takes a turn when she meets Eric, someone she genuinely connects with, causing her two worlds to collide. Elizabeth Olsen Joins Kristen Stewart & Oscar Isaac in Vampire Drama "Flesh of the Gods"

Elizabeth Olsen is joining an already impressive cast in the upcoming vampire drama, "Flesh of the Gods." She will star alongside Kristen Stewart and Oscar Isaac in this 80s-set film directed by Panos Cosmatos, known for his visually stunning and surreal style ("Mandy"). "Flesh of the Gods" is set in a glamorous, surrealistic world of hedonism, thrills, and violence. The story centers on Raoul and Alex, a married couple living in luxury in 1980s Los Angeles. Each night, they descend from their skyscraper condo into the electric nightlife of the city. Their lives are disrupted when they encounter the mysterious Nameless (Elizabeth Olsen) and her hard-partying cabal. Raoul and Alex are seduced into a world of excess and danger, blurring the lines between reality and fantasy. "Headless" Reimagines the Headless Horseman with a Modern Twist

The Spierig brothers, Peter and Michael (known for "Fall 2" and "Jigsaw"), are set to direct "Headless," a contemporary take on the Headless Horseman legend. This reimagining promises a blend of horror, action, and dystopian elements, with nods to "Mad Max" and "The Terminator." The story follows a rudderless hitchhiker and a driven woman avenging her family’s death. Together, they must stop a motorcycle-riding, semi-immortal ghoul that feeds off carnage on desert highways by decapitating its head and getting its head far enough away, long enough, from its relentlessly pursuiting still-living body.
